THE All Progress Congress (APC) Kaduna State campaign council, will tomorrow hold a summit to educate women on their role in successful elections in a democratic dispensation.

The summit, which has the theme “The role of Women in Elections” will be attended by professional women groups, women in business, rural women and Market women associations.

According to Ruth Akali, the Director of APC Women Mobilization in the state, the first paper that will be presented at the summit is “The role of women in determining the outcome of an election” and the second paper would highlight on “The role of women as peacemakers and as stabilizing force in the aftermath of elections.”

Mallam Nasir El Rufa’I , who is the candidate of APC in Saturday’s governorship polls in Kaduna State would deliver the keynote address and also participate in an interactive session with participants at the conference.

The summit would begin at 9.am to 4.pm.
